ZAPATA v. STATE

No. A08A0530.

662 S.E.2d 271 (2008)

ZAPATA v. The STATE.

Court of Appeals of Georgia.

May 12, 2008.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Little, Bates & Kelehear, Sam F. Little, for Appellant.

Kermit Neal McManus, Dist. Atty., Stephen Eric Spencer, Asst. Dist. Atty., for Appellee.


MILLER, Judge.

Following a jury trial, Jesus Zapata was convicted of two counts of child molestation and one count of sexual battery. Zapata filed a motion for new trial, which was denied by the trial court. He now appeals, alleging ineffective assistance of counsel in that his trial counsel moved for a directed verdict at the close of the State's evidence, thereby allowing the trial court to reopen the evidence and enable the State to introduce additional evidence...
